Hyderabad’May 31 (PMI) Bharatiya Janata Party Former State Spokesperson, Telangana, Mir Firasath Ali Baqri, met with Director General of Police, Telangana State, Dr. Jitender IPS, on Friday to submit a formal representation requesting enhanced security arrangements for the upcoming holy month of Muharram.
The meeting took place at the Telangana State Police Headquarters in Hyderabad and was attended by Syed Rehan Hyder. During the interaction, Mir Firasath Ali Baqri held an in-depth discussion with the DGP regarding comprehensive security planning at Ashoorkhanas across the state from June 27 to September 3, spanning 68 days of religious observance.
The representation highlighted the need for deployment of specialized police forces such as the Task Force, Special Branch, Special Operation Team (SOT), and SHE Teams during the Muharram period to ensure peace, safety, and smooth conduct of processions.
Key events discussed during the meeting included the 10th Muharram procession on July 6, Arbaeen procession on August 15, Chup Taziya on September 2, and Eid-e-Zehra on September 3. Mir Firasath Ali Baqri emphasized the historical and spiritual importance of these observances and urged the state police to make necessary arrangements well in advance.
He also appreciated Dr. Jitender’s prompt response, patience in hearing concerns, and his commitment to maintaining law and order during significant religious events. “The DGP’s proactive support and open communication are truly inspiring and reassuring to the community,” said Baqri following the meeting.
The representation is part of Mir Firasath Ali Baqri’s continued efforts to advocate for communal harmony and ensure religious events in Telangana are conducted in a peaceful and organized manner.
The DGP assured the delegation that all necessary security protocols would be reviewed and that the safety of citizens during Muharram will remain a top priority for the state police.(pressmediaofindia)
